For the incoming director: Korvast Industries has agreed in principle to sell the Marleth coatings unit to Pellbrook Holdings. Diligence closes next month. Headcount transfer covers 140 staff; the Ardenfield plant conveys with the deal. Retained liabilities are limited to pre-close environmental claims. Your priorities: stabilize the remaining portfolio and manage transition services for twelve months. Deal economics are acceptable, not exceptional. The rationale for timing appears in the note below.

management briefing: Headcount on the Beldor team goes from 26 to 123 by the end of February. Gross margin on Beldor came in at 5 percent against a plan of 37 percent.

## Zero-downtime migrations

Plugin authors targeting the Corvane platform must assume two schema versions are live simultaneously during any migration window. Write code that tolerates both the old and new column layouts: add columns first, backfill asynchronously, then flip reads, then drop. The Corvane migrator enforces pacing limits so backfills never saturate the primary; your plugin's background jobs share the same budget. The pacing constants the migrator currently applies are listed here.

constants for tageg-kagag:
QUOTAS = {
    "kelax": 495,
    "istath": 366,
    "tammir": 108,
    "novdor": 730,
    "casax": 816,
    "quenael": 874,
    "pelius": 403,
}

Visitor policy — Marrowgate Expo pop-up office. Contractors sign in at the Velstrand Hall kiosk before each visit. Tools stay in the storage cage overnight. No access before 07:00 or after 20:00. Escorts are required on the show floor only. The pop-up office door is keypad-locked; contractors on the approved list may use the code below.

door code, yagap-bahof: bdg-O-05